Ryan Lee wrote:
> Chris Bizer wrote:
>> Thinking further about it, we could also get rid of the format
>> description
>> at all and attach the content properties directly to the format. Two
>> examples.
> As we are no longer using a box model, then it is likely someone might
> want to describe how to separate properties, making this change
> unworkable (i.e., it will not be clear which content is being separated,
> values or properties). As much as I don't like format description
> because of the difficulty it introduces in writing the ontology, it does
> seem like an important element.
>> Example: Add commas between property values and a period to the end of a
>> list of homepages.
>> :formatHomepage rdf:type fresnel:Format ;
>> fresnel:formatDomain foaf:homepage ;
>> fresnel:contentAfter ", "^^xsd:string ;
>> fresnel:contentLast "."^^xsd:string ;
>> fresnel:valueStyle "basicLabel"^^fresnel:FormatClass
>> .
> On a separate issue, is contentLast taking the place of the last comma
> produced by contentAfter? Or is it going to look like:
> 'red, green, orange, .'
> Could we say contentBetween in addition?
We can do everything with just contentAfter and contentLast, provided
that the behaviour of contentLast is to override contentAfter for the
last element. So I am in favour of this instead of introducing another
element in the Fresnel vocab.
Emmanuel Pietriga
INRIA Futurs - Projet In Situ tel : +33 1 69 15 34 66
Bat 490, Université Paris-Sud fax : +33 1 69 15 65 86
91405 ORSAY Cedex FRANCE http://www.lri.fr/~pietriga
Received on Mon Jun 27 2005 - 09:10:58 EDT